What Drives Hydroxocobalamin B12 Injection Price in Real Life

When people ask about hydroxocobalamin b12 injection price, they’re often trying to plan for their budget without getting trapped by confusing pricing components. In my hands-on workflow, I focus on the categories that reliably change the total cost.

1) Concentration and vial volume

Two products can both be “hydroxocobalamin B12 injection,” but one might be prepared at a different concentration or with a different total mL per vial. If you’re comparing prices across sellers or settings, convert to a common basis—commonly cost per vial and also cost per mg of hydroxocobalamin (when strength is stated clearly).

2) Compounding and fulfillment type

Compounded products may involve different preparation pathways than standard manufactured items. That can affect lead time, pharmacy handling, and how pricing is structured. I’ve seen patients underestimate how much “how it’s sourced” impacts availability and price consistency.

3) Quantity dispensed for the course

A single vial price isn’t the whole story. Many regimens are scheduled—so the cost relevant to you is the cost of the entire course your clinician prescribes, not just one dispensing event.

4) Where you buy (and how it’s billed)

Pricing often differs by pharmacy model and whether your plan covers it under a specific benefit. Even when the underlying drug is the same, the way the claim processes can change what you personally pay.

5) Time sensitivity and availability

In practice, availability affects urgency. If a medication is hard to source, it may involve longer fulfillment or substitute pathways—both can raise total cost. In my experience, planning ahead by confirming stock and lead time helps avoid “rush pricing” surprises.

How to Compare Prices Without Getting Mismatched

Here’s the comparison method I’ve used with clinicians and patients to avoid bad apples-to-oranges comparisons. You can do this quickly with what’s on the prescription and pharmacy quote.

Step-by-step price comparison

  1. Confirm the exact strength (mg/mL) on the label or quote.
  2. Confirm total volume per vial (mL).
  3. Calculate total drug amount per vial: (mg/mL) × (mL per vial) = total mg per vial.
  4. Compare cost per vial first.
  5. Then compare cost per mg if different vial sizes or concentrations are involved.
  6. Check quantity dispensed (how many vials match your prescribed course).

Simple example (how to think about it)

If one quote lists a 10 mL vial at a given mg/mL strength, and another quote lists a different mL vial at a different strength, you’ll get misleading conclusions if you compare only vial price. Cost per mg is the safer basis for “like-for-like” comparison.

Clinical Context: When Hydroxocobalamin Injections Are Typically Used

Hydroxocobalamin (vitamin B12) injections are commonly used when B12 deficiency is significant or when oral absorption may be unreliable. Clinicians may recommend injections for specific deficiency causes and monitor response. I’ve worked with care teams where treatment plans evolve—dose schedules can change based on symptoms, lab trends, and patient tolerance.

Why this matters to your cost planning

Because the regimen can vary, your total spending depends on how many injections you’ll need over the initial repletion phase and any subsequent maintenance. If you’re budgeting, ask your prescriber or pharmacist about the intended course length so you’re not forced into last-minute reordering.

Practical Ways to Reduce “Total Cost Surprises”

Price matters, but the hidden costs are often about timing, incomplete information, and refill misalignment. These are the tactics that consistently help in real-world medication access.

1) Ask for the full course estimate up front

Before committing, request pricing that reflects the number of vials required for the prescribed schedule. This reduces the risk of budgeting only for the first dispensing event.

2) Confirm insurance and billing category

If you have coverage, confirm whether the medication is billed under a benefit that applies to your situation. Even with coverage, your out-of-pocket can vary significantly depending on how the claim is processed.

3) Plan around lead time

If compounded formulation is involved, lead time can matter. In my experience, confirming processing and shipping time early prevents gaps in treatment that can lead to additional appointments or emergency fill attempts.

4) Keep label details for future refills

Once you receive the first vial, keep the label data (strength and vial size) so refills stay consistent. Miscommunication here is a common driver of unnecessary cost differences.
